From the Rolls-Royce experimental archive: a quarter of a million communications from Rolls-Royce, 1906 to 1960's. Documents from the Sir Henry Royce Memorial Foundation (SHRMF).
Decision not to proceed with K.I.R. ignition plugs as standard for the 20 HP Chassis.
Identifier | ExFiles\Box 58\3\ Scan079 | |
Date | 19th June 1924 | |
/19180. Order Office. c. EP.{G. Eric Platford - Chief Quality Engineer} c. Hs.{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air} BY18/H.{Arthur M. Hanbury - Head Complaints} 19. 6. 24. [STAMP: RECEIVED] 20 HP. IGNITION PLUGS. It has been decided as a result of my memo of this morning's date to EP{G. Eric Platford - Chief Quality Engineer} and Hs{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}, that we cannot agree to carrying on with the K.I.R. Ignition Plugs as standard on the 20 HP. Chassis. Would you therefore kindly return 1000 of the 1500 K.I.R. Plugs, only retaining 500 to be used by the Test Dept. at their discretion, to obtain further information. We should then order 1500 of the old type plugs, whilst returning only 1000 of the new. BY.{R.W. Bailey - Chief Engineer} [Handwritten initials: BY] | ||
